Former NASA Leader Says SpaceX Should Build NASA’s Moon Rocket – Futurism
“I would not have recommended the government build a $27 billion rocket.”

Former NASA deputy administrator Lori Garver believes that the agencys extremely expensive and overdue Space Launch System (SLS), the rocket meant to return American astronauts to the surface of the Moon, just isnt worth the money and the wait.
In a new interview with CBS, Garver argued that I would not have recommended the government build a $27 billion rocket, referring to the SLS, when the private sector is building rockets nearly as large for no cost to the taxpayer.
